Due to an accident with Barney's recently invented time machine, C2 creates an alternate world where Carl is a nerd, Chloe is a cheerleader, and clones don't exist. C2 and nerdy Carl rush to build a time machine of their own.
The Crashman's become hopelessly lost in the woods, and begin to disappear one by one, apparently falling victim to a chainsaw-wielding backwoods psychopath.
Carl gets stuck with an evil foreign exchange student who threatens to reveal Carl's 'big secret' to the world unless Carl will hook him up with Chloe and get Damien out of his way.
After accidentally burning down the local soup kitchen while performing volunteer hours for Carl, C2 brings a pair of friendly hobos home to spend Thanksgiving weekend.
C2 embarrasses Carl by wearing an old pair of Carl's super hero jammies in public. Carl has to don the super jammies himself and go to the rescue when Skye and C2 get into trouble while trying to expose a puppy mill.
Mr. Agar's dream of becoming school vice-principal becomes everyone else's nightmare. Even worse, it seems Carl has turned informant to help Agar rule with an iron fist.
Mystery abounds when Carl, C2 and several others are marooned on a tiny island, and Carl's efforts to return to civilization keep getting foiled by a mysterious saboteur who may be one of their own.
Carl learns that the island he has been marooned on holds even more mysteries than he had first suspected, such as who is capturing the castaways and why?
Skye has to has to rethink her stance against human cloning when she finally meets C2. But first, she has to help Carl save C2 from an angry and fearful mob that is the result of her protest gone too far.
